**Alert: partition_missing_next_month**
Service: LedgerVault archive store. The monthly partition for the upcoming period was not created by the Saturday job. Writes will fail at month rollover if unresolved. Check the partition-maker cron logs first; the usual culprit is a lock held by the compaction task. If the job is dead, create the partition manually using the template script, then re-enable the cron. Do not backfill older partitions during business hours. Manual creation steps are on the internal page below.

wiki page, kagep-bajog: https://sentry.braskdata.internal/issue

## Further reading

We vendor all third-party fonts into the Brightquill release bundle — no CDN fetches at runtime, ever. The `fontsync` script pulls approved families from the Typecellar mirror and pins checksums in `fonts.lock`. If a release fails the font audit, it's almost always a stale lockfile. Licensing notes, the approved-family list, and the refresh procedure are all kept on the internal page linked here.

operations page: https://jira.qorvelsys.internal/browse/pages/browse/pages

# Break-Glass: Catalog Cache Invalidation

Scope: the Pinrow product catalog at Veldstone Retail. If stale prices persist after a purge and the Hollowmere invalidation queue is wedged, use break-glass to flush the edge tier directly. Contractors: get verbal sign-off from the catalog lead first. Steps: open the Hollowmere admin shell, select emergency-flush, confirm the tenant, and run it once — repeated flushes thrash the origin. Access is logged and expires after 20 minutes. Unseal the admin shell with the passphrase below.

recovery phrase for kahop-tajog: istix-casvan